ABSTRACT
The acute toxicity of a methanol extract of the leaf of carica
papaya (1.2g/ml) was investigated in male rats (150- 227g). In acute
toxicity studies carried out in rats, LD 50 of the extract was
3675mg/kg after intravenous administration. Clinical signs of depression
(inactivity and anorexia), decrease in motor activity, analgesia and loss of
righting reflex were observed.
Histopathologic
examination showed inhibition or depletion of the glycogen storage and lipid
formation at a dose above 1556, 4 mg/kg.
It was concluded that methanol extract of the leaf of carica
papaya when given at a dose of 15556.4 mg (equivalent to 0.24g dried
leaf)/kg intravenously does not cause any death or toxic effects in rats.
A further study is required to confirm its efficacy in the
treatment of various conditions in folk medicine.
INTRODUCTION AND
LITERATURE REVIEW
The treatment given native
doctors and herbalists throughout Nigeria to their patients often includes the administration
of exudates of entire plants or extracts of the roots, stems, bark, leaves,
fruits, seeds, juice of local plants. Frequently neither the ‘’doctor’’ nor the
patient attributes the healing action to the plant itself. The ‘’doctor’’ may
say that he has discovered a plant with leaves or roots possessing a spirit is
not manifested until he has spoken some magic words or has chanted an incantation
over the plant (Oliver 1960).
Apart from the native doctors who treat the more
complicated and resistant cases, the more common ailments are treated by
ordinary people in the village; in most cases elderly women with some knowledge
of the local plats. In a number of cases also, the recovery of the patient may
be attributable to his faith or his natural resistance rather than to the
‘’doctors’’ skill. However parts of the plants have been shown to have real
therapeutic value (Tang, 1979). Extracts of the roots of Heptacyclum zenkeri
have been used as an aphrodisiac and in the treatment of local infections
and veneral disease (Duah et al, 1981). Stem bark of Eucalyptus
maculate is used generally in the treatment of asthma and chronic
bronchitis (Mishra and Misra, 1980).
carica papaya (pawpaw) is a popular tropical and subtropical
fruit. It was originally a native of America but is now extensively grown in
all tropical countries including India (Dutta, 1979).
The plants are small, sparsely branched trees with soft
wood. The soft wood is formed largely from the phloem that gives the soft large
trunck much of its rigidity. The leaves are alternative, digitately lobed
or foliated and without stipules. The fruit is a berry and its latex contains
papain, an important protease (enzyme) used in tenderizing meat and also for
removing biological stains from fibrics (Gledhill, 1972).
The leaf of carica papaya has been used in
places like Mexico, Indonesia, India, Africa, Philippines and Ghana under
various conditions in folk medicine (Table 1). These conditions include Asthma,
Beriberi, Elephantoid growth, Foul wounds, kidney and bladder trouble, Nervours
pain and Epithellioma (Tang, 1979)

According to Weast et
al (1981), the organic constituents of the carica papaya
leaf are Ascorbic acid (Vitamin C), B-carotine (Provitamin A) and Carpaine. The
presense of the carpaine alkaloid in the leaf of carica papaya is
of toxicological interest (Kucera et al, 1974). However two new
capaine analogues dehydrocarpaine I and dehydrocarpaine II have been isolated
from the alkaloid extract of the dried leaves of carica papaya
(Tang, 1979).
Carpaine (C28H50O4N2)
is a crystalline alkaloid found in the leaves of carica papaya
and a dies built by two identical halves, the carpaic acid molecules
(pelletier, 1970). Carpaine was isolated by Greshoff (1890). It has a melting
point (M.P) of 1211oc and a boiling point of 215 -2350C
(vacuum). It is also soluble in alcohol but only slightly soluble in water
(Tang, 1979).
It has been reported that carpaine is essentially a heart
poison capable of lowering pulse frequency and depressing contral nervous
system (Heary, 1974). Tuffley and williian (1951) had earlier reported that
carpaine reduces the contractile power of the heart.
The effect of carpaine on the circulatory function has been
recently studied at the medical school University of Hawaii, it was found that
carpaine has a dose dependent effect on lowering the blood pressure and heart
rate of the rat (Tang 1979).
This study on acute
toxicity test will reveal the toxic effects produced by a single dose of a
methanol extract of the leaf of carica papaya in rats. The use of
rats in this investigation is based on convenience and availability.
Species differences cosntiturte the single largest
difficulkty in the interpretation of toxicity testing. In most circumstancves
too little is known about the way differing animal species react to toxic
chemicals for it to be possible to give any logical reason for choosing one
species rather than another (Paget and Barnes, 1964)
All laboratory toxicity studies are directed towards a
single objective: the safe use of the candidate substance in man. This
objective has never been fully realized because the available laboratory tests
are incapable of detecting certain types of toxic manifestations which occur in
man.
Since this plant carica papaya is readily
available in many localities in Nigeria including Port Harcourt, the
possibility of using it as cheap and readily available drug for the above named
diseases has to be considered.
As part of the safety evaluation of the leaf of carica
papaya this study was undertaken to determine the lethal dose: LD50
(that is the dose that will kill 50% of the rats used) together with doses
producing specific toxic effects using the methanol extract of the leaf of carica
papaya.
